[Men's Basketball] Saint Xavier Drops CCAC Contest to Holy Cross, 93-92

CHICAGO – The Saint Xavier University men's basketball team (14-4, 8-2 CCAC) lost to Holy Cross College (Ind.), 93-92, in Chicagoland Collegiate Athletic Conference (CCAC) play Saturday afternoon at the Shannon Center in Chicago, Ill. after the Saint made a jump-shot with :06 left in regulation. The Cougars had a chance to tie or take the lead after a foul by HCC with :04 remaining, however the 'one-and-one' attempt hit the back iron and the three-point shot at the buzzer fell short to snap SXU's nine-game win streak. Junior forward Kevin Bishop (Cleveland, Ohio/Pikeville/Parkland/Sinclair/Benedictine) led Saint Xavier with 20 points on 8-for-10 shooting and had a season-high four assists, along with three rebounds. It was his fifth game of the season with 20 or more points and improves his team-leading shooting percentage to 61.7 percent (119-for-193).
